Frequently Asked Questions about Flushing
How much are Studio apartments in Flushing?
There are currently 8,314 Studio Apartments in Flushing with rent ranges from $1,300 to $10,000 with an average price of $2,970.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Flushing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Flushing ranges from $1,100 to $8,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,102.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Flushing c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Flushing range from $2,100 to $8,920.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,772.
How expensive are Flushing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 1,964 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Flushing on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,200 to $9,180 - averaging $3,668 for the location.
